Discover more concerning what the term "as is" implies in realty contracts, as well as the benefits and disadvantages of purchasing a residential or commercial property on those terms. If you're in the market for a new home, you may have come across the term "as is" in a realty listing.The legal term "as is" in a composed agreement means that the purchaser must want to accept the home in its existing condition. If you are the customer, this indicates that you pass up the possibility to ask the seller to make any kind of fixings or reduce the rate based on issues the home may have.

If a home is noted "as is," this means that the seller will not make any kind of repair services or give any type of rate decrease for troubles of the whole property, which includes both the home and the grounds. Some typical concerns covered by an "as is" summary can consist of leaks, mold or mold, or significant structural issues, to call simply a few.
